The unique environment of federal buildings in Washington D.C. presents significant challenges for process servers. Common obstacles include:
Federal buildings often have multiple layers of security, including:
These measures can delay or restrict access, requiring process servers to plan their visits carefully.
Many federal employees work in secure areas that are not accessible to the public. Process servers may face difficulties locating the intended recipient without prior authorization or assistance from building staff.
Serving legal papers to high-ranking officials, such as agency heads or judges, requires special consideration due to their sensitive roles and potential security concerns.
Defendants or witnesses working in federal buildings may attempt to avoid being served by exploiting the complexities of access and security protocols.
Legal deadlines often remain unchanged, even when challenges arise. Process servers must act quickly and strategically to ensure timely service.

Q: Can legal papers be served directly to federal employees?
A: In most cases, legal papers must be served to the employee’s official address or through the head of the agency, depending on the circumstances.
Q: What documentation is required for access to federal buildings?
A: Process servers typically need government-issued identification and any relevant authorization or appointment details.
Q: Are there alternative methods for serving legal papers in federal buildings?
A: Yes, courts may approve alternative methods, such as service by mail or service through an authorized agent, if direct service is impractical.
Q: How long does it take to complete service in federal buildings?
A: The timeframe varies depending on the complexity of the case, the recipient’s role, and the building’s security protocols.
